Long-Period Grating with Asymmetrical Modulation for Curvature Sensing
We propose and demonstrate a curvature sensor based on long-period fiber grating (LPFG) with asymmetric index modulation. The LPFG is fabricated in single-mode fiber with femtosecond laser micromachining.

High Temperature Optical Fiber Sensor Based on Compact Fattened Long-Period Fiber Gratings
A compact high temperature fiber sensor where the sensor head consists of a short fattened long period fiber grating (F-LPFG) of at least 2 mm in length and background loss of −5 dBm is reported.
